LA GOUVERNANCE MUTUALISTE COMME LEVIER DE CONTROLE
2012
The knowledge governance studies the way the administrators can limit the actions of the leaders otherwise than by disciplinary mechanisms. The study of the strategic process is a means to analyze more finely these mechanisms. The results indicate that the elected representatives participate actively in the definition of the strategy of their territory and it through several complementary control levers. Diagnostic and interactive levers are pointed out.
Etude de la gouvernance d’une association dans un contexte de fusion
2018
International audience; L’objet de ce travail est d’étudier la gouvernance cognitive au sein d’associations qui ont fusionné. Une étude de cas réalisée au sein d’une association d’aide à domicile permet de mettre en lumière les confrontations entre les différents acteurs et le processus d’apprentissage qui nourrit des adaptations dynamiques et innovantes.

Digital Storytelling Project as a Way to Engage Students in Twenty-First Century Skills Learning
2020
[EN] This paper is focused on the implications of a collaborative digital storytelling project on student engagement in the higher education context. The empirical study is conducted with an interdisciplinary group of bachelor students in a Nordic University (N = 22) and a university in Southern Europe (N = 21), and the data are collected through an online student survey. The results demonstrate that the digital storytelling project supported students’ behavioral, emotional, and cognitive engagement. Understand and optimize mental strategies during motor learning
2022
Motor imagery-based motor learning, also known as mental practice, can improve motor performance. However, questions remain concerning the mechanisms involved in mental practice, at the neurophysiological and behavioral levels. In a first study, we show an increase of short-interval intracortical inhibition during motor imagery, supporting the hypothesis that motor imagery induces the generation of an inhibited motor command. Apprentissage de modalités auxiliaires pour la localisation basée vision
2018
In this paper we present a new training with side modality framework to enhance image-based localization. In order to learn side modality information, we train a fully convo-lutional decoder network that transfers meaningful information from one modality to another. We validate our approach on a challenging urban dataset. Experiments show that our system is able to enhance a purely image-based system by properly learning appearance of a side modality. Compared to state-of-the-art methods, the proposed network is lighter and faster to train, while producing comparable results.
